Инжектирането е тип атака, която включва инжектиране на зловреден код в приложение или система. Това е една от най-често срещаните и опасни заплахи за киберсигурността, тъй като може да се използва за получаване на достъп до чувствителни данни, прекъсване на услуги и дори поемане на контрол над система. Атаките чрез инжектиране могат да се използват за използване на уязвимости в уеб приложения, бази данни и операционни системи.
Атаките чрез инжектиране обикновено се извършват чрез използване на пропуски при валидиране на въвеждане в приложение. Това става чрез изпращане на злонамерен код през поле за въвеждане, като например поле на формуляр или URL параметър. След това злонамереният код се изпълнява от приложението, което позволява на атакуващия да получи достъп до системата или данните.
Атаките чрез инжектиране могат да бъдат предотвратени чрез прилагане на правилно валидиране на входа. Това включва валидиране на всички потребителски данни, за да се гарантира, че са в правилния формат и не съдържат злонамерен код. Освен това е важно да използвате параметризирани заявки при взаимодействие с бази данни, тъй като това ще предотврати изпълнението на зловреден код.
Атаките чрез инжектиране могат да имат сериозни последствия, така че е важно да предприемете стъпки за защита на вашите приложения и системи от този тип на атака. Чрез внедряване на правилно валидиране на входа и използване на параметризирани заявки, можете да помогнете да гарантирате, че вашите приложения и системи са защитени от атаки чрез инжектиране.
Ползи
Injection е мощен инструмент за разработка на софтуер, който може да помогне на разработчиците да създават по-ефективни и сигурни приложения. Може да помогне за намаляване на количеството код, необходим за създаване на програма, както и за намаляване на времето, необходимо за разработване на програма. Инжектирането може също така да помогне за намаляване на риска от уязвимости в сигурността, като гарантира, че се изпълнява само разрешен код. В допълнение, инжектирането може да помогне за подобряване на производителността на приложенията, като позволи на разработчиците да използват повторно код и да намалят количеството код, необходим за създаване на програма. И накрая, инжектирането може да помогне за намаляване на разходите за разработка, като позволи на разработчиците да използват повторно код и да намалят времето, необходимо за разработка на програма. Injection е мощен инструмент, който може да помогне на разработчиците да създават по-ефективни и сигурни приложения.
Съвети Инжектиране
1. Винаги използвайте параметризирани заявки, за да предотвратите атаки чрез SQL инжектиране. Параметризираните заявки принуждават разработчика първо да дефинира целия SQL код и след това да предаде всеки параметър към заявката по-късно. Това помага да се предотврати вмъкването на техен собствен SQL код в заявката от злонамерени потребители.
2. Използвайте съхранени процедури, когато е възможно. Съхранените процедури са предварително компилирани и могат да помогнат за предотвратяване на атаки чрез SQL инжектиране.
3. Използвайте най-малко привилегирования потребителски акаунт, когато се свързвате към базата данни. Това ще помогне за предотвратяване на достъп на злонамерени потребители до чувствителни данни.
4. Потвърдете всички потребителски данни. Уверете се, че всички въведени от потребители данни са правилно дезинфекцирани и валидирани, преди да бъдат използвани в заявка.
5. Използвайте инструмент ORM (Object Relational Mapping). ORM помагат за абстрахиране на слоя база данни и могат да помогнат за предотвратяване на атаки чрез SQL инжектиране.
6. Използвайте защитна стена за уеб приложения (WAF). WAF може да помогне за откриване и блокиране на злонамерени заявки, които може да съдържат атаки чрез SQL инжектиране.
7. Наблюдавайте вашата база данни за подозрителна дейност. Редовно наблюдавайте вашата база данни за подозрителна дейност и предприемайте подходящи действия, ако бъде открита такава.
8. Обучете разработчиците си. Уверете се, че вашите разработчици са наясно с рисковете от атаки чрез SQL инжектиране и как да ги предотвратят.
често задавани въпроси
Q1: Какво е инжекция?
A1: Инжекцията е метод за въвеждане на вещество, като например лекарство, в тялото с помощта на игла и спринцовка. Инжекциите обикновено се използват за доставяне на лекарства, като например инсулин, в тялото.
Q2: Какви са различните видове инжекции?
A2: Има няколко вида инжекции, включително мускулни, подкожни, интравенозни и интрадермални инжекции. Интрамускулните инжекции се инжектират директно в мускула, докато подкожните инжекции се инжектират точно под кожата. Интравенозните инжекции се инжектират директно във вена, а интрадермалните инжекции се инжектират в дермалния слой на кожата.
Q3: Какви са рисковете, свързани с инжекциите?
A3: Инжекциите могат да носят риск от инфекция, кървене и тъкан щета. Важно е да следвате инструкциите на вашия доставчик на здравни услуги, когато прилагате инжекция. Освен това е важно да използвате чиста игла и спринцовка, за да намалите риска от инфекция.
Q4: Какво трябва да направя, ако изпитам някакви нежелани реакции след инжекция?
A4: Ако изпитате някакви нежелани реакции след инжекция , като болка, подуване или зачервяване на мястото на инжектиране, свържете се с вашия доставчик на здравни услуги. Важно е да потърсите медицинска помощ, ако получите някакви сериозни нежелани реакции, като затруднено дишане, болка в гърдите или замайване.
Заключение
Инжекцията е чудесно продаван артикул за всеки, който иска да подобри здравето и благосъстоянието си. Това е безопасен и ефективен начин за доставяне на лекарства директно в кръвта, което позволява по-бързо усвояване и по-добри резултати. Инжектирането също е чудесен начин за прилагане на витамини и минерали, както и други добавки, за да се подобри цялостното здраве. Инжекцията е чудесен избор за тези, които искат да вземат здравето си в свои ръце и да извлекат максимума от своите лекарства. Инжектирането е удобен и рентабилен начин да извлечете максимума от вашите лекарства и добавки. Това също е чудесен начин да се уверите, че извличате максимума от вашите лекарства и добавки, тъй като позволява по-прецизно доставяне на лекарството или добавката. Инжекцията е чудесен избор за тези, които искат да поемат контрол върху здравето си и да извлекат максимума от своите лекарства и добавки. Инжектирането е безопасен и ефективен начин за доставяне на лекарства директно в кръвния поток, което позволява по-бързо усвояване и по-добри резултати. Инжектирането също е чудесен начин за прилагане на витамини и минерали, както и други добавки, за да се подобри цялостното здраве. Инжекцията е чудесен избор за тези, които искат да вземат здравето си в свои ръце и да извлекат максимума от своите лекарства. Инжектирането е удобен и рентабилен начин да извлечете максимума от вашите лекарства и добавки. С инжекцията можете да сте сигурни, че извличате максимума от вашите лекарства и добавки, тъй като позволява по-прецизно доставяне на лекарството или добавката. Инжекцията е чудесен избор за тези, които искат да поемат контрол върху здравето си и да извлекат максимума от своите лекарства и добавки.